Skip to content

Commit

Permalink
Merge branch 'master' into html
Browse files Browse the repository at this point in the history
  • Loading branch information
karmelyoei authored Feb 25, 2020
2 parents 2856eb8 + 0bf9d33 commit d9b9821
Show file tree
Hide file tree
Showing 4 changed files with 225 additions and 21 deletions.
125 changes: 125 additions & 0 deletions database/config/build.sql
Original file line number Diff line number Diff line change
@@ -0,0 +1,125 @@
BEGIN;

DROP TABLE IF EXISTS students, teachers, grades, courses;


CREATE TABLE IF NOT EXISTS courses(
course_id SERIAL PRIMARY KEY,
course_title TEXT NOT NULL

);

INSERT INTO courses (course_id, course_title) VALUES(1,'Physics');
INSERT INTO courses (course_id, course_title) VALUES(2,'Maths');
INSERT INTO courses (course_id, course_title) VALUES(3,'Chemistry');
INSERT INTO courses (course_id, course_title) VALUES(4,'Arabic');
INSERT INTO courses (course_id, course_title) VALUES(5,'Biology');
INSERT INTO courses (course_id, course_title) VALUES(6,'coding');
INSERT INTO courses (course_id, course_title) VALUES(7,'English');

CREATE TABLE IF NOT EXISTS students(
student_id SERIAL PRIMARY KEY,
student_name TEXT NOT NULL ,
student_birth INTEGER ,
student_sex TEXT NOT NULL,
student_address TEXT ,
student_EMAIL VARCHAR(320),
student_img VARCHAR(250) NoT NULL

);

INSERT INTO students (student_id , student_name, student_birth, student_sex, student_address, student_EMAIL,student_img) VALUES (1,'Tasnin' , 8/8/1996, 'Female', 'Bethlehem' ,'[email protected]','https://www.google.com/url?sa=i&url=https%3A%2F%2Fwww.forbes.com%2Fsites%2Fangelauyeung%2F2019%2F10%2F24%2Fjeff-bezos-is-no-longer-the-richest-person-in-the-world%2F&psig=AOvVaw0aqN38lJLcC_x4z05J8o3B&ust=1582725738852000&source=images&cd=vfe&ved=0CAIQjRxqFwoTCPjl3f3u7OcCFQAAAAAdAAAAABAU');
INSERT INTO students (student_id, student_name, student_birth, student_sex, student_address, student_EMAIL,student_img) VALUES (2,'Matt' , 25/5/1995, 'Male', 'Bethlehem' ,'[email protected]','https://www.google.com/url?sa=i&url=https%3A%2F%2Fwww.pexels.com%2Fsearch%2Fperson%2F&psig=AOvVaw0aqN38lJLcC_x4z05J8o3B&ust=1582725738852000&source=images&cd=vfe&ved=0CAIQjRxqFwoTCPjl3f3u7OcCFQAAAAAdAAAAABAD');
INSERT INTO students (student_id, student_name, student_birth, student_sex, student_address, student_EMAIL,student_img) VALUES (3,'karmel' , 4/9/1996, 'Female', 'Bethlehem' ,'[email protected]','https://www.google.com/url?sa=i&url=https%3A%2F%2Fengineering.unl.edu%2Fkayla-person%2F&psig=AOvVaw0aqN38lJLcC_x4z05J8o3B&ust=1582725738852000&source=images&cd=vfe&ved=0CAIQjRxqFwoTCPjl3f3u7OcCFQAAAAAdAAAAABAb');
INSERT INTO students (student_id, student_name, student_birth, student_sex, student_address, student_EMAIL,student_img) VALUES (4,'Harry' , 17/11/1996, 'Male', 'Bethlehem' ,'[email protected]','https://www.google.com/url?sa=i&url=https%3A%2F%2Fp-upload.facebook.com%2Fnasdaily%2Fphotos%2F%3Fref%3Dpage_internal&psig=AOvVaw0aqN38lJLcC_x4z05J8o3B&ust=1582725738852000&source=images&cd=vfe&ved=0CAIQjRxqFwoTCPjl3f3u7OcCFQAAAAAdAAAAABAO');


CREATE TABLE IF NOT EXISTS relation(
relation_id SERIAL PRIMARY KEY,
course_id INT ,
FOREIGN KEY course_id REFERENCES courses (course_id)
student_id INT,
FOREIGN KEY student_id REFERENCES students (student_id),

);

INSERT INTO relation( course_id , student_id) VALUES (1,1);
INSERT INTO relation( course_id , student_id) VALUES (2,1);
INSERT INTO relation( course_id , student_id) VALUES (3,1);
INSERT INTO relation( course_id , student_id) VALUES (4,1);
INSERT INTO relation( course_id , student_id) VALUES (5,1);
INSERT INTO relation( course_id , student_id) VALUES (6,1);
INSERT INTO relation( course_id , student_id) VALUES (7,1);
INSERT INTO relation( course_id , student_id) VALUES (1,2);
INSERT INTO relation( course_id , student_id) VALUES (2,2);
INSERT INTO relation( course_id , student_id) VALUES (3,2);
INSERT INTO relation( course_id , student_id) VALUES (4,2);
INSERT INTO relation( course_id , student_id) VALUES (5,2);
INSERT INTO relation( course_id , student_id) VALUES (6,2);
INSERT INTO relation( course_id , student_id) VALUES (7,2);
INSERT INTO relation( course_id , student_id) VALUES (1,3);
INSERT INTO relation( course_id , student_id) VALUES (2,3);
INSERT INTO relation( course_id , student_id) VALUES (3,3);
INSERT INTO relation( course_id , student_id) VALUES (4,3);
INSERT INTO relation( course_id , student_id) VALUES (5,3);
INSERT INTO relation( course_id , student_id) VALUES (6,3);
INSERT INTO relation( course_id , student_id) VALUES (7,3);
INSERT INTO relation( course_id , student_id) VALUES (1,4);
INSERT INTO relation( course_id , student_id) VALUES (2,4);
INSERT INTO relation( course_id , student_id) VALUES (3,4);
INSERT INTO relation( course_id , student_id) VALUES (4,4);
INSERT INTO relation( course_id , student_id) VALUES (5,4);
INSERT INTO relation( course_id , student_id) VALUES (6,4);
INSERT INTO relation( course_id , student_id) VALUES (7,4);


CREATE TABLE IF NOT EXISTS grades(
grade_id SERIAL PRIMARY KEY,
grade_mark VARCHAR(50) ,
course_id INT ,
FOREIGN KEY course_id REFERENCES courses (course_id) ,
student_id INT,
FOREIGN KEY student_id REFERENCES students (student_id)
);

INSERT INTO grades( grade_mark , course_id , student_id) VALUES(84,1 ,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(90, 2 ,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(94,3 ,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(88,4,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(70,5 ,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(57,6 ,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(50,7,1 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(77,1 ,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(70,2 ,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(87,3 ,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(88,4,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(99,5 ,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(60,6 ,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(90,7,2);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(91,1 ,3 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(80,2 ,3 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(98,3 ,3 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(94,4,3 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(99,5 ,3 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(91,6 ,3 );
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(90,7,3);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(64,1 ,4);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(83,2 ,4);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(57,3 ,4);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(50,4,4);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(90,5 ,4);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(70,6 ,4);
INSERT INTO grades( grade_mark , course_id , student_id) VALUES(88,7,4);





CREATE TABLE IF NOT EXISTS teachers(
teacher_id SERIAL PRIMARY KEY,
teacher_address TEXT ,
teacher_phone INTEGER

);

COMMIT;
45 changes: 45 additions & 0 deletions public/student.html
Original file line number Diff line number Diff line change
@@ -0,0 +1,45 @@
<!DOCTYPE html>
<html lang="en">

<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
<link rel="stylesheet" href="./style.css">
</head>

<body>
<section class="topsection">
<img src="./imges/school.png" alt="school picture" />
<h1>Student Managment System</h1>
</section>

<section class="student">
<form class="student_form">
<div>
<input value="Type your ID" type="search" class="head_search">
</div>
<div>
<input value="submit" type="button" class="head_button">
</div>
</form>
<div class="student_profolio">
<img src="team-01.png" class="student_img">
<div class="student_profolio_name">
<h2>Ali</h2>
<h3>ID:134223</h3>
</div>
</div>
<div class="student_info">
<h3>location:</h3>
<h3>birthday:</h3>
<h3>sex:</h3>
<h3>phone:</h3>


</div>
</section>
</body>

</html>
76 changes: 55 additions & 21 deletions public/style.css
Original file line number Diff line number Diff line change
@@ -1,37 +1,70 @@
.student_profolio {
display: flex;
flex-direction: column;
justify-content: flex-start;
padding-left: 100px;
box-shadow: 5px 5px 5px #aaaaaa;
}

.student_img {
border-radius: 50%;
width: 130px;
height: 130px;
padding: 10px;
}

.student_profolio_name {
padding: 10px 0 10px 0;
}

.student_form {
display: flex;
flex-direction: row;
padding: 10px 35px 10px 20px;
justify-content: space-around;
}

.student_info {
padding: 40px;
box-shadow: 5px 5px 5px 5px #aaaaaa;
height: 320px;
/* background-color: oldlace */
}

* {
padding: 0;
margin: 0;
padding: 0;
margin: 0;
}

.topsection {
background-color: #4e9cc9;
width: 100%;
height: 109px;
display: flex;
flex-direction: row;
align-items: center;
background-color: #4e9cc9;
width: 100%;
height: 109px;
display: flex;
flex-direction: row;
align-items: center;
}

.topsection img {
width: 50px;
height: 50px;
padding: 10px;
width: 50px;
height: 50px;
padding: 10px;
}

.topsection h1 {
margin-top: 22px;
font-family: "Anton";
font-size: 6vw;
color: white;
margin-top: 22px;
font-family: "Anton";
font-size: 6vw;
color: white;
}

.icons {
width: 100%;
height: auto;
padding: 5px;
display: flex;
flex-direction: column;
align-items: center;
width: 100%;
height: auto;
padding: 5px;
display: flex;
flex-direction: column;
align-items: center;
}

.icons img {
Expand Down Expand Up @@ -84,3 +117,4 @@
color: white;
font-size: 25px;
}

Binary file added public/team-01.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.

0 comments on commit d9b9821

Please sign in to comment.